九章为什么不能编程
-
九章算法是一家以培训人工智能和算法工程师为主的教育机构,主要提供在线课程和实战项目等学习资源。虽然九章在培训领域深受欢迎,但是九章本身并不能提供编程服务的原因主要有以下几点:
-
教育机构定位:九章算法的定位是培训机构,而不是开发团队或编程服务提供商。九章的目标是通过教授算法和人工智能的理论知识,帮助学员提升技能,并成功应对面试和求职。
-
专注于算法:九章算法的核心课程主要围绕算法和人工智能展开,课程内容涵盖了机器学习、深度学习、数据挖掘等领域。与此相比,编程只是算法工程师工作中的一部分,九章更专注于教授算法和数据科学的相关知识。
-
编程技术多样性:编程技术有很多种,如Python、Java、C++等,而九章算法并不限制学员使用特定的编程语言或技术。学员可以根据自己的需求和兴趣选择适合自己的编程语言和技术。
-
编程服务外包:编程服务通常是指为客户开发软件、网站或应用程序等。这种服务需要开发团队具备丰富的编程经验和技术能力,而九章算法的主要目标是培养学员的算法和数据科学能力,并不涉及为外部客户提供编程服务。
综上所述,九章算法不能提供编程服务的原因是其定位为培训机构,专注于教授算法和人工智能的知识。编程服务通常需要专业的开发团队和丰富的编程经验,与九章的教育目标不太相符。
1年前 -
-
九章算法是一家提供在线编程题库和面试准备服务的技术公司,为什么说九章不能编程呢?以下是一些可能的原因:
-
九章的主要业务是提供算法面试准备服务,而不是教授编程知识。九章的课程和题库主要关注算法和数据结构,旨在帮助用户提高在面试中的表现。虽然编程是算法实现的一部分,但九章的重点是教授算法解决方法,而不是编程语言的细节。
-
编程是一项需要实践和练习的技能。九章的课程和题库提供了一些编程挑战,但没有提供系统的编程教学。学习编程需要理论知识和实际操作的结合,需要大量的编程练习和项目实践。九章的服务主要是为面试准备提供支持,而不是为初学者提供编程教学。
-
编程语言的选择和使用是个人偏好和实际需求的问题。九章并没有限定用户必须使用哪种编程语言来解决算法问题。不同的编程语言有不同的特点和适用场景,选择合适的编程语言也是编程学习的一部分。九章更注重的是算法思维的培养和解题技巧的提升,而不是特定编程语言的学习。
-
编程技能的提升需要全面的学习和实践。九章的服务虽然能够帮助用户提高在算法面试中的表现,但要成为一个优秀的程序员,还需要学习其他方面的知识,如软件工程、系统设计、数据库等。九章的课程和题库可能无法涵盖所有与编程相关的知识和技能。
-
学习编程需要时间和耐心。编程是一项需要不断学习和实践的技能,需要花费大量的时间和精力。九章的服务可能无法满足每个用户的学习速度和需求。学习编程需要持续的学习和实践,九章的服务只是一个辅助工具,用户还需要自己进行深入的学习和练习。
总之,虽然九章算法提供了在线编程题库和面试准备服务,但其主要关注点是算法和面试准备,而不是教授编程知识。学习编程需要全面的学习和实践,九章的服务可能无法满足每个用户的需求。对于想要学习编程的人来说,还需要寻找其他资源和途径来提升自己的编程技能。
1年前 -
-
九章算法是一个在线的算法学习平台,主要提供算法相关的在线课程和题目练习。虽然九章算法平台本身不能直接进行编程,但是它提供了丰富的算法学习资源和实践题目,帮助学习者提高算法编程能力。
以下是九章算法平台的主要特点和使用方法:
-
算法课程:九章算法平台提供了一系列的算法课程,涵盖了从基础到高级的各种算法知识。学习者可以通过观看教学视频和阅读教材来学习算法的基本概念、原理和应用。
-
题目练习:九章算法平台提供了大量的算法题目,涵盖了常见的算法问题和面试题。学习者可以通过解答这些题目来巩固所学的知识,并提高编程能力和解题能力。
-
代码评审:九章算法平台提供了代码评审功能,学习者可以将自己的代码提交上去,由专业的算法工程师进行评审和指导。通过代码评审,学习者可以了解自己代码的优缺点,并学习到更好的编程习惯和技巧。
-
讨论社区:九章算法平台有一个活跃的讨论社区,学习者可以在这里与其他学习者交流和讨论算法问题。这个社区提供了一个互相学习和分享的平台,可以帮助学习者更好地理解和掌握算法知识。
九章算法平台的主要目的是帮助学习者系统地学习和掌握算法知识,并提供实践题目来提高编程能力。虽然平台本身不能直接进行编程,但通过学习课程、解答题目和参与讨论,学习者可以逐渐提高自己的编程能力,并应用算法知识解决实际问题。
1年前 -